SIMMS, Justice:

By previous order of the Court, Initiative Petition No. 332, State Question No. 598, was held violative of art. 4, section 1 and art. 5, section 55 of the Oklahoma Constitution. Those portions repugnant to the Constitution were held to be such an integral part of the whole Question that they could not be severed from the remainder and the petition was therefore stricken in the entirety.
